This recipe was extracted from Rare old receipts (1906) by Jacqueline Harrison Smith, page 1. The excerpt below is the record exactly as published.

WASHINGTON CAKE. Valerian Spencer Fullerton. Contributed by Mr. John Lambert, Philadelphia, Pa. i$4 lbs. flour, $i lb. butter, ij4 lbs. sugar, 1 pt. milk, 10 eggs, 1 glass brandy, 1 nutmeg, 12 cloves, 1 lb. currants, 1 lb. raisins, 1 teaspoon Pearl ash dissolved in brandy
